本発明は、ドラム式洗濯機の外箱側面の構成に関するものである。   The present invention relates to a configuration of a side surface of an outer box of a drum type washing machine.

従来、この種のドラム式洗濯機の外箱側面構成においては、脱水時等の振動を低減する為に、プレス加工等による薄板鋼板に水平方向に凹状絞り部を複数条形成することが提案されてきた(例えば、特許文献1参照)。   Conventionally, in this type of drum-type washing machine outer case side surface configuration, in order to reduce vibration during dehydration, etc., it has been proposed to form a plurality of concave constricted portions in a horizontal direction on a thin steel plate by pressing or the like. (For example, see Patent Document 1).

図4は、特許文献1に記載された従来のドラム式洗濯機の外観斜視図を示すものである。図4に示すように、縦長略直方体の外箱41構成は、上面に上面化粧カバー30、前面上方に表示等も備えた操作パネル31、前面中央に開閉自在にドア32を配した前面化粧カバー33、前面下方に前面下部カバー34、下方には脚部39を取り付けた脚台35を構成する。   FIG. 4 shows an external perspective view of a conventional drum type washing machine described in Patent Document 1. As shown in FIG. As shown in FIG. 4, the configuration of the outer box 41 of a substantially vertically long rectangular parallelepiped is composed of an upper face decorative cover 30 on the upper surface, an operation panel 31 having a display and the like on the upper front, and a front decorative cover having a door 32 that can be opened and closed at the front center. 33, a front lower cover 34 is formed below the front surface, and a leg base 35 with a leg portion 39 attached below is formed.

外箱41の側面には、薄板鋼板で形成した縦長略矩形の左右両面の側面板36で外箱全体構成の重量を脚台35と共に支えるものである。   On the side surface of the outer box 41, the weight of the entire outer box structure is supported together with the leg stand 35 by side plates 36 on the left and right sides of a vertically long and substantially rectangular shape formed of a thin steel plate.

上記側面板36には、製品持ち運び用の把手部38や、注意シール等貼りつけ凹部40を形成しているので、その部分は除いて、側面全面に水平方向に長手方向を有する凹状絞り部37を複数条形成する。前記凹状絞り部37は、その凹状絞り部の面積、即ち塑性変形をしている面積を、凹状絞り部37を加工していない部分の面積より広くすることにより、側面板36全体の面剛性を高め、側面板36の持つ共振周波数を大きくし、脱水時の振動周波数から遠ざけることで外箱41の振動を低減する面剛性を高めるものであった。   Since the side plate 36 is formed with a handle portion 38 for carrying the product and a concave portion 40 for attaching a caution seal or the like, the concave diaphragm portion 37 having a longitudinal direction in the horizontal direction on the entire side surface except for the portion. Form multiple lines. The concave diaphragm portion 37 has a surface rigidity of the entire side plate 36 by making the area of the concave diaphragm portion, that is, the area where plastic deformation is performed, larger than the area of the portion where the concave diaphragm portion 37 is not processed. The surface rigidity of the outer casing 41 is reduced by increasing the resonance frequency of the side plate 36 and increasing the resonance frequency away from the vibration frequency during dehydration.

そして、凹状絞り部37を側面板全面に水平方向に設定しているが、これは側面板36が縦方向に縦長略矩形をしているので、凹状絞り部37の上下幅として設定した寸法Pが一定ならば、凹状絞り部37の数を多数構成できるからで、凹状絞り部37を多数構成して面剛性を高める構成であった。   The concave diaphragm portion 37 is set in the horizontal direction on the entire side plate. This is because the side plate 36 has a substantially rectangular shape in the vertical direction, and the dimension P set as the vertical width of the concave diaphragm portion 37. Is constant, it is possible to configure a large number of concave diaphragm portions 37, so that a large number of concave diaphragm portions 37 are configured to increase the surface rigidity.

特開2010−63893号公報JP 2010-63893 A

しかしながら、前記従来の構成では、側面板が縦方向に縦長略矩形している場合には凹状絞り部の数を多数構成でき、特に縦方向の面剛性を高めることができるが、側面板の形状が略4角形に近い形状の場合には、例えば上下一方向の剛性は高めることができても、側面板に加わる振動は、水平方向あるいは上下のいずれの方向からでも伝達してくるので、剛性は必ずしも十分とはいえないものであった。   However, in the conventional configuration, when the side plate is substantially rectangular in the vertical direction, a large number of concave diaphragm portions can be configured, and in particular, the surface rigidity in the vertical direction can be increased. In the case of a shape close to a square, for example, even if the vertical rigidity can be increased, the vibration applied to the side plate is transmitted from either the horizontal direction or the vertical direction. Was not necessarily sufficient.

従って、脱水運転時に側面板の振動が増大し異音の発生や、前面中央のドアの操作で特に閉じる際に強い力で操作した際に、側面板の振動にて反響し異音が発生するという課題があった。   Therefore, the vibration of the side plate increases during dehydration operation, and abnormal noise is generated, and when operating with a strong force especially when closing the front center door, the side plate vibrates and generates abnormal noise. There was a problem.

本発明は、上記従来の課題を解決するもので、側面板に加わる振動が、水平方向あるいは上下のいずれの方向から伝達されても、側面板の面剛性を高め、振動や異音の発生を低減することを目的としている。   The present invention solves the above-mentioned conventional problems, and even if vibration applied to the side plate is transmitted from either the horizontal direction or the upper and lower directions, the surface rigidity of the side plate is increased and vibration and abnormal noise are generated. The purpose is to reduce.

前記従来の課題を解決する為に、本発明のドラム式洗濯機は、外箱の側面部を構成し鋼板で形成した左右の側面板と、前記外箱の前面部を構成し前面略中央に開閉自在にドアを配した前面カバーと、前記外箱の上面を構成する上面カバーと、前記外箱内方に回転ドラムを回転自在に軸支持した水槽と、前記水槽を揺動自在に垂下防振支持するサスペンションと、外箱底板から前記水槽の振動を減衰する減衰ダンパーと、前記水槽の前記ドア側にて前記前面カバーと水密的に固定したドアパッキンとを備え、前記左右の側面板は凹状絞り部を複数条形成し、前記凹状絞り部は、前記ドア側である前面に近いほど大きい曲率の円弧形状とし、後方に向かうにつれて曲率が小さくなる円弧形状としたものである。   In order to solve the above-mentioned conventional problems, the drum type washing machine of the present invention comprises left and right side plates formed of steel plates that constitute the side portion of the outer box, and the front portion of the outer box at the substantially front center. A front cover provided with doors that can be opened and closed, an upper surface cover that constitutes the upper surface of the outer box, a water tank that rotatably supports a rotating drum inside the outer box, and a drooping prevention mechanism that allows the water tank to swing freely The suspension includes a suspension for vibration support, a damping damper that attenuates vibration of the water tank from an outer box bottom plate, and a door packing that is watertightly fixed to the front cover on the door side of the water tank. A plurality of concave diaphragm portions are formed, and the concave diaphragm portions have an arc shape with a larger curvature as it approaches the front surface on the door side, and an arc shape with a curvature that decreases toward the rear.

これにより、脱水運転時の水槽あらゆる方向の挙動に対応した側面板の面剛性を確保でき、低振動・低騒音が達成される。   Thereby, the surface rigidity of the side plate corresponding to the behavior of the water tank in all directions during the dehydration operation can be secured, and low vibration and noise can be achieved.

本発明のドラム式洗濯機は、いかなる形状の側面板にも対応して面剛性を高め得るので、高速脱水時の外箱の振動を低減することで、低振動・低騒音を達成することができる。   Since the drum type washing machine of the present invention can increase the surface rigidity corresponding to any shape of the side plate, low vibration and low noise can be achieved by reducing the vibration of the outer box during high-speed dewatering. it can.

以下、本発明の実施の形態について、図面を参照しながら説明する。また、この実施の形態によって本発明が限定されるものではない。   Hereinafter, embodiments of the present invention will be described with reference to the drawings. Further, the present invention is not limited by this embodiment.

(実施の形態1)
図1は、本発明の第1の実施の形態におけるドラム式洗濯機の外観斜視図を示すものであり、図2は、同ドラム式洗濯機の側面方向から見た縦断面図を、図3は、同ドラム式洗濯機の側面版の正面図を示すものである。
(Embodiment 1)
FIG. 1 is an external perspective view of the drum type washing machine according to the first embodiment of the present invention. FIG. 2 is a longitudinal sectional view of the drum type washing machine as viewed from the side. These show the front view of the side version of the drum type washing machine.

図1において、略立方体の外箱1構成は、上面に上面化粧カバー(上面カバー)2、前面上方に表示等も備えた操作パネル3、前面中央に開閉自在にドア4を配した前面化粧カバー(前面カバー)5、前面下方に前面下部カバー6、下方には脚部7を構成する。   In FIG. 1, the structure of the substantially cubic outer box 1 consists of a top decorative cover (top cover) 2 on the upper surface, an operation panel 3 with a display on the upper front, a front decorative cover having a door 4 that can be opened and closed at the front center. (Front cover) 5, a front lower cover 6 is formed below the front surface, and a leg portion 7 is formed below.

外箱1の側面には、薄板鋼板で形成した略正方形または矩形の側面板8(図1は、右側面板を図示しており左右対称に反対側には左側面板が存在する)で外箱全体構成の重量を脚部7と共に支える。   On the side surface of the outer box 1 is a substantially square or rectangular side plate 8 formed of a thin steel plate (FIG. 1 shows the right side plate, and the left side plate exists on the opposite side in a symmetrical manner). Supports the weight of the construction together with the legs 7.

上記側面板8には、前記ドア4側である前面側から、後方に行くに従って、平面形状が曲率の異なる凹状絞り部9を複数条形成している。この側面板に形成した凹状絞り部9により薄板鋼板の側面板8の面剛性を高め、製品の脱水運転時の側面板8の振動や異音の低減と、強い操作力でドア4を閉じた際の側面板8の反響音等を削減するものである。   The side plate 8 is formed with a plurality of concave diaphragm portions 9 having different curvatures in the planar shape from the front side which is the door 4 side toward the rear. The concave diaphragm portion 9 formed on the side plate increases the surface rigidity of the side plate 8 of the thin steel plate, and the door 4 is closed with a strong operation force and the vibration and noise of the side plate 8 during the dehydration operation of the product. This reduces the reverberation sound of the side plate 8 at the time.

図2の縦断面図により、側面板に作用する振動を説明する。   The vibration acting on the side plate will be described with reference to the longitudinal sectional view of FIG.

外箱1の内方には、モータ10にて回転駆動される回転ドラム11が、水槽12内に回転自在に軸支持される。前記水槽12は、上部を上面化粧カバー2よりサスペンション13にて揺動自在に垂下防振支持されると共に、下部では外箱底板15から減衰ダンパー14にて振動振幅低下させるように減衰支持される。   A rotating drum 11 that is rotationally driven by a motor 10 is rotatably supported in the water tank 12 inside the outer box 1. The upper part of the water tank 12 is supported by the suspension 13 so that the upper part of the water tank 12 can swing freely. The lower part of the water tank 12 is damped and supported by the damping damper 14 so as to reduce the vibration amplitude. .

さらに、水槽12の前方のドア4側には、ドア4を閉じた時にドア内ガラス16と水密的に接するゴム等可撓性材質のドアパッキン17で前面化粧カバー5に水密的に固定されている。   Further, the front door 4 side of the water tank 12 is watertightly fixed to the front decorative cover 5 with a door packing 17 made of a flexible material such as rubber that comes in watertight contact with the inner glass 16 when the door 4 is closed. Yes.

水槽12の、特に脱水運転時の高速回転では、回転ドラム11内部に洗濯物衣類18は多種多様な分布をするので水槽12の挙動は上下、左右、前後と複雑な動きを生じる。   When the aquarium 12 is rotated at a high speed particularly during a dehydrating operation, the laundry garment 18 has a wide variety of distributions inside the rotating drum 11, so that the behavior of the aquarium 12 causes complicated movements such as up and down, left and right, and front and rear.

従って、サスペンション13や、減衰ダンパー14より上面化粧カバー2や底板15を介して側面板8(図2では図示せず)に伝達される振動は、上下方向の波動が主体となる一方、水槽12が前後方向の挙動の場合にはドアパッキン17より、前面化粧カバー5を介して側面板8(図2では図示せず)に伝達される。   Therefore, the vibration transmitted from the suspension 13 and the damping damper 14 to the side plate 8 (not shown in FIG. 2) via the top decorative cover 2 and the bottom plate 15 is mainly composed of vertical waves, while the water tank 12. Is transmitted from the door packing 17 to the side plate 8 (not shown in FIG. 2) via the front decorative cover 5.

従って、側面板8の剛性は、サスペンション13や、減衰ダンパー14より上面化粧カバー2や底板15を介して側面板8に伝達される主として上下方向の振動と、ドアパッキン17部より、前面化粧カバー5を介してドア4側の前方から側面板8に伝達される水平方向の振動、及びドア開閉時の水平方向の衝撃、に対応する面剛性が必要となる。   Therefore, the rigidity of the side plate 8 is mainly the vertical vibration transmitted from the suspension 13 and the damping damper 14 to the side plate 8 via the top decorative cover 2 and the bottom plate 15, and the front packing 17 from the door packing 17 part. Therefore, it is necessary to have surface rigidity corresponding to the horizontal vibration transmitted from the front side of the door 4 to the side plate 8 via 5 and the horizontal impact when the door is opened and closed.

特に、側面板形状が、前後より上下方向寸法が大きく勝る縦長略矩形でなく、前後と上下方向寸法が近似した矩形や正方形状に近い形状の場合には、側面板剛性は上下と前後方向に同様の面剛性が特に求められる。   In particular, when the shape of the side plate is not a vertically long and roughly rectangular shape whose vertical dimension is significantly greater than that of the front and rear, but a shape close to a rectangle or square whose front and rear and vertical dimensions are approximated, the rigidity of the side plate is determined in the vertical and longitudinal directions. Similar surface rigidity is particularly required.

図3の側面板の正面図において、側面板8の凹状絞り部9は、ドア4の最前側にある略半円(略半楕円)凹状絞り部9a、ドア4の前側から略円弧形状の曲率の大きい凹状絞り部9bから、順次後方に行くに従って9c、9d、9e、と曲率を小さく変化させた形状に形成している。なお、凹状絞り部9の「凹」は外箱1の外方から外箱1の内方に向けて「凹」状となっている。   In the front view of the side plate in FIG. 3, the concave diaphragm portion 9 of the side plate 8 has a substantially semicircular (substantially semi-elliptical) concave diaphragm portion 9 a on the foremost side of the door 4, and a substantially arc-shaped curvature from the front side of the door 4. 9c, 9d, and 9e are formed in a shape in which the curvature is gradually changed from the concave diaphragm portion 9b having a large diameter toward the rear. In addition, the “concave” of the concave diaphragm portion 9 has a “concave” shape from the outside of the outer box 1 toward the inside of the outer box 1.

曲率の設定は、懸垂曲線(カテナリー)で設定し、図3で、ドア4側に最も近接した位置に略半円凹状絞り部9aを構成し、とくに側面板のドア側中央部近傍の面剛性を高めている。   The curvature is set by a catenary curve, and in FIG. 3, a substantially semicircular concave throttle portion 9a is formed at a position closest to the door 4 side. Is increasing.

一方、ドア4側から最も離れた図3で右端の凹状絞り部9eの平面形状は略垂直に近似する曲率の小さい円弧状のカテナリー曲線に構成し、上下の端部Aが側面板の上下角隅部19に近接するように形成し、凹状絞り部の面積をできるだけ広くしている。   On the other hand, the planar shape of the concave diaphragm 9e at the right end in FIG. 3 farthest from the door 4 side is configured as an arc-shaped catenary curve having a small curvature approximating a substantially vertical shape, and the upper and lower ends A are the upper and lower angles of the side plate. It is formed so as to be close to the corner portion 19, and the area of the concave diaphragm portion is made as wide as possible.

なお、鋼板材質の側面板8の板厚を0.6mmとした場合、前記凹状絞り部9は、プレス加工等により2.0〜4.0mmの深さに絞り加工を施すことで塑性変形させ、側面板の面剛性を高めている。   When the thickness of the side plate 8 made of a steel plate is 0.6 mm, the concave drawn portion 9 is plastically deformed by drawing to a depth of 2.0 to 4.0 mm by pressing or the like. The surface rigidity of the side plate is increased.

また、凹状絞り部9b、9c、9d、9eの上下方向の中心は、ドア4の中心ならびに回転ドラム11の回転軸上にあるほうが好適である。   In addition, it is preferable that the vertical centers of the concave diaphragm portions 9 b, 9 c, 9 d, and 9 e lie on the center of the door 4 and the rotation axis of the rotary drum 11.

以上のように構成した洗濯機について、その動作、作用を説明する。   About the washing machine comprised as mentioned above, the operation | movement and an effect | action are demonstrated.

近年、ドラム式洗濯機は節水効果が大きいとして、その需要が増加すると共に、洗える衣類容量の増大化の製品開発が進んできた。その対応として、図2で示した回転ドラム11の回転軸方向さ長さ(奥行き)を増やすことで対応が進んでいる。従って、容量増大に伴い製品自体の奥行きが大きくなり、側面板8も、従来は上下に縦長形状の矩形が多かったが、近年は前後と上下方向寸法が近似した矩形や、正方形状に近い形状が増えている。   In recent years, the drum type washing machine has a great water-saving effect, so that the demand for the drum-type washing machine has been increased and the development of products for increasing the washable clothes capacity has been advanced. As the countermeasure, the countermeasure is advanced by increasing the length (depth) of the rotating drum 11 in the rotation axis direction shown in FIG. Therefore, as the capacity increases, the depth of the product itself increases, and the side plate 8 has conventionally had a vertically long rectangular shape, but in recent years, a rectangular shape that approximates the front and rear and vertical dimensions, or a shape that is close to a square shape. Is increasing.

そのような状況で、本願の側面板は、サスペンション13や、減衰ダンパー14より上面化粧カバー2や底板15を介して側面板8に伝達される主として上下方向の振動と、ドアパッキン17より、前面化粧カバー5を介してドア4側の前方から側面板8に伝達される水平方向の振動の2方向に対応するように、画一的な縦方向凹状絞り部や、水平方向のみの凹状絞り部で面剛性を確保するのでなく、複雑な複数条の円弧凹状絞り部を構成したもので、各円弧により、縦方向、水平方向の面剛性を高めている。   Under such circumstances, the side plate of the present application is mainly driven by the vertical vibration transmitted from the suspension 13 and the damping damper 14 to the side plate 8 via the top decorative cover 2 and the bottom plate 15, and from the door packing 17. A uniform vertical squeezing part or a squeezing squeezing part only in the horizontal direction so as to correspond to two directions of horizontal vibration transmitted from the front side of the door 4 to the side plate 8 via the decorative cover 5 In addition to ensuring the surface rigidity, a complicated plurality of circular arc concave diaphragm portions are configured, and the surface rigidity in the vertical and horizontal directions is enhanced by each arc.

特に、脱水運転時、ドア4近傍のドアパッキン17を介して側面板8にB方向(図3)から振動が伝達されてくる振動に対し、略半円凹状絞り部9aにより強い面剛性が得られるので、側面板8全体への振動伝達が低減され、製品全体の振動の抑制を行うことができる。   In particular, during the dehydrating operation, strong surface rigidity is obtained by the substantially semicircular concave throttle portion 9a against vibration transmitted from the B direction (FIG. 3) to the side plate 8 via the door packing 17 near the door 4. Therefore, vibration transmission to the entire side plate 8 is reduced, and vibration of the entire product can be suppressed.

また、ドア4を解放状態から、強い力で閉じる操作をした際には、ドアパッキン17および前面化粧カバー5を介して左右の側面板に衝撃が伝わる際にも、脱水運転時と同様、略半円凹状絞り部9aの強い面剛性により、側面板8全体の反響音が低減される。   Further, when the door 4 is closed with a strong force from the released state, the impact is transmitted to the left and right side plates via the door packing 17 and the front decorative cover 5 as in the dehydration operation. Due to the strong surface rigidity of the semicircular concave diaphragm 9a, the reverberant sound of the entire side plate 8 is reduced.

以上のように、本発明にかかるドラム式洗濯機は、側面板の面剛性、とくに前面ドア近傍を高めることにより脱水時の外箱振動や、ドア開閉時の異音を低減させることができるので、振動を伴い、かつ開閉ドアを有する他の製品、たとえば脱水機等の用途にも適用できる。   As described above, the drum type washing machine according to the present invention can reduce the vibration of the outer box during dehydration and the abnormal noise when opening and closing the door by increasing the surface rigidity of the side plate, particularly the vicinity of the front door. It can also be applied to other products with vibration and having an open / close door, such as a dehydrator.
